Inn Details
The Heartland Country Resort is a sprawling haven for both families and honeymooners. It is peacefully nestled amidst the beautiful rolling hills and shady woodlands northeast of Columbus, Ohio. The log home suites, situated on almost one hundred acres, provide a private country retreat with all the amenities, horseback riding and other special services. Couples find welcome seclusion in the privacy of the setting and the luxurious comfort of the suites. The suites have solid log walls, cathedral ceilings, full kitchens or kitchenettes, private entrances, private porches with swings, two-person jacuzzis, and glass-front stoves.

My husband & I were looking for a nice place to stay not too far from home for a little spring break weekend getaway w/our 3 kids. The cabin we stayed in was rustic yet charming. I think we stayed in the North American cabin which had 2 bedrooms-master w/full bath & second w/full & cot w/half bath. The sofa in living room opened up to bed which was more comfy/desireable for our 9 year old. There was a small fireplace that warmed us up after being out on the unusually chilly March day. We had a fully equipped kitchenette where we ate our own breakfast from home and take out pizza. We couldn't get the dvd to work to watch some of the older movies offered. Wish there were directions, b/c it didn't work like most do but the VCR did. The Jacuzzi didn't work either so that was a bit disappointed for the kids who wanted to use it since they aren't allowed to use mom/dad's at home. We asked to do farm chores and the nice young man led the kids and was informative-they brushed the horses, fed dogs, cats, goats, chickens and collected eggs too-their fave. part! We went on a hour long horse trail ride that was a lot of fun. Fast food places were nearby but stay away from Kelly's pizza, it was a mess, bathroom had hole in floor, no soap & sink didn't work. My husband thought it wasn't as clean as it should be, it was a little dusty but bedrooms, bathrooms clean. There was a bonfire that we were going to use but it got too cold at night & was too dark that the kids were scared to be out in woods! Overall nice little getaway, Very nice propreiter. Kids loved going to visit animals whenever including the golden retrievers that roamed the lodge and puppies upstairs but couldn't hold them b/c they were 'champion' puppies that were sold. My kids said they would love to return next year. we'll see...I personally like to try new places.
